Output 267572fb3dfb1a4d0b1f1fcd13a146b5ba861a7e39df9274e5cf9b12852caecb:35

value
28512959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c665b2d7159d898a41fcdd13eabf82fb1fe15f1 OP_EQUAL
address
MGKj1uhWnsjDpZka26iqSatmQpqbxPfp2F
transaction
267572fb3dfb1a4d0b1f1fcd13a146b5ba861a7e39df9274e5cf9b12852caecb
spent
true